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Assist with management of a portfolio of clients by assisting with renewals/retention of current clients.
  • Maintain files and documents in accordance with office procedures.
  • Deliver excellent customer service for benefit, billing or claims questions.
  • Assist with monitoring and reporting on plan performance.
  • Update policy changes or inform clients of upcoming policy regulations or requirements.
  • Assist with preparation of renewal quotes by assisting with analyzing and spreadsheeting the quotes for the client.
  • Assist with compliance for employer regulations and requirements.
  • Assist with providing plan education or amendments as necessary.
  • Other duties as assigned.
